Gold Ore Grinding Machine 1100 1200 model Water Wet Pan Mill
Wet pan mill, also called gold grinding machine, water pan mill,
gold round mill, chilean mill, and wheel grinding machine. It is
mainly used for grinding gold, silver, lead, zinc, iron, copper and
other ores after they are crushed. All ores that can be processed
by ball mills can be used by wet pan mills. The final product size
is less than 150 meshes which is suitable for the next
beneficiation process. 1100 1200 model wet pan mill have become a
popular gold grinding mill machine for small and medium gold miners
due to its advantages of easy installation, high capacity and low
investment in mining sites such as Sudan, Zambia, Mauritania, Saudi
Arabia, Egypt ,Nepal.

Working principle
The motor drives the speed reducer, the speed reducer drives the
roller on the main shaft to operate. We add materials and liquid in
a certain proportion for grinding. After grinding, the monomer
dissociated mineral fine particles are brought to the liquid
surface in the mixed slurry, and are discharged through the
overflow discharge port arranged on the basin, and enter the next
operation process for processing. The coarse-grained minerals
settle at the bottom of the grinding base and continue to be ground
until the fineness reaches the standard. There is a screen set at
the discharge mouth of the basin, (the screen mesh size should be
reasonably set according to the mineral type and sorting
requirements) it can strictly control the classification particle
size to avoid over-crushing of minerals or uneven particle size,
creating good conditions for subsequent operations.
High efficiency and high capacity: The castings are made of high quality casting steel lining, which greatly increases the service life and the capacity by 30%-60%.
Low invest: Wet pan mill can achieve the same grinding effect as a ball mill, but the cost is much lower than that of a ball mill. It is the fastest way for small and medium-sized miners to obtain pure gold without large investments.
Low maintenance cost: The grinding rollers and grinding rings are made of high quality casting steel alloy, ensuring a service life of at least 3 years, reducing maintenance and spare parts replacement costs for customers.
Energy saving and high resource utilization : The surface of the roller and ring is smooth without any holes or cracks to avoid the loss of mercury or gold, so that the wet pan mill can make full use of effective resources.
Low pollution: We can provide sealing covers for wet pan mills to reduce air pollution.
Specification
Model | Type (mm) | Max feed | Capacity(t/h) | Power(kw) | Weight(ton) |
1600 | 1600x350x200x460 | <25 | 1-2 | Y6L-30 | 13.5 |
1500 | 1500x300x150x420 | <25 | 0.8-1.5 | Y6L-22 | 11.3 |
1400 | 1400x260x150x350 | <25 | 0.5-0.8 | Y6L-18.5 | 8.5 |
1200 | 1200x180x120x250 | <25 | 0.25-0.5 | Y6L-7.5 | 5.5 |
1100 | 1100x160x120x250 | <25 | 0.15-0.25 | Y6L-5.5 | 4.5 |
1000 | 1000x180x120x250 | <25 | 0.15-0.2 | Y6L-5.5 | 4.3 |
Wet pan mill operating rules
1. The operator must be trained by the manufacturer and fully
understand the structure and performance of the machine before they
can operate. The operator must comply with the relevant safety and
shift transfer system.
2. Before work, strictly follow the lubricating oil regulations to
refuel, and keep the oil amount appropriate, the oil circuit
smooth, and the oil injection port clean.
3. Check whether the circuit, electrical parts, line connectors,
switches are solid and complete. If there is damage, it must be
repaired and replaced.
4. Check whether the parts of the machine are intact, whether the
roller rotates flexibly, the tightness of the transmission belt,
and whether the transmission parts are securely connected; After
the inspection is completed, the boot idling for 3-5 minutes,
confirm that the parts are normal, before adding the ore, and must
be added in strict accordance with the prescribed amount of ore, it
is strictly prohibited to overload work.
5. When feeding the ore, the material must be sifted to prevent
hard metal debris such as iron blocks from being put into the mill
and damaging the machine.
6. When stopping for some reason, the material in the roller should
be removed first, and then started. It is strictly prohibited to
forcibly start with heavy load.
7. When the machine is in operation, the operator shall not leave,
and should often inspect the working conditions of various parts.
In case of abnormal sound of the equipment, large vibration of the
roller, excessive temperature of the reducer oil, overheating of
the motor housing, and slip of the transmission belt, the machine
should be shut down immediately.
8. During the shutdown process, when the roller is not completely
stopped, it is not allowed to extend the arm and other instruments
into the roller basin to prevent injury and damage to the machine.
